{"id":"https://openalex.org/W2627018814","doi":"https://doi.org/10.17706/jsw.12.6.454-471","title":"Managing Inconsistencies in UML Models: A Systematic Literature Review","display_name":"Managing Inconsistencies in UML Models: A Systematic Literature Review","publication_year":2017,"publication_date":"2017-06-01","ids":{"openalex":"https://openalex.org/W2627018814","doi":"https://doi.org/10.17706/jsw.12.6.454-471","mag":"2627018814"},"language":"en","primary_location":{"id":"doi:10.17706/jsw.12.6.454-471","is_oa":true,"landing_page_url":"https://doi.org/10.17706/jsw.12.6.454-471","pdf_url":"http://www.jsoftware.us/vol12/263-JSW15240.pdf","source":{"id":"https://openalex.org/S114141714","display_name":"Journal of Software","issn_l":"1796-217X","issn":["1796-217X"],"is_oa":true,"is_in_doaj":false,"is_core":true,"host_organization":"https://openalex.org/P4310318660","host_organization_name":"Academy Publisher","host_organization_lineage":["https://openalex.org/P4310318660"],"host_organization_lineage_names":["Academy Publisher"],"type":"journal"},"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Journal of Software","raw_type":"journal-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":true,"oa_status":"diamond","oa_url":"http://www.jsoftware.us/vol12/263-JSW15240.pdf","any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5011181608","display_name":"Driss Allaki","orcid":"https://orcid.org/0000-0002-0307-3518"},"institutions":[{"id":"https://openalex.org/I4210153527","display_name":"Institut National des Postes et T\u00e9l\u00e9communications","ror":"https://ror.org/052bnvt46","country_code":"MA","type":"education","lineage":["https://openalex.org/I4210153527","https://openalex.org/I4210167103"]}],"countries":["MA"],"is_corresponding":true,"raw_author_name":"Driss Allaki","raw_affiliation_strings":["National Institute of Posts and Telecommunications, Rabat, Morocco"],"affiliations":[{"raw_affiliation_string":"National Institute of Posts and Telecommunications, Rabat, Morocco","institution_ids":["https://openalex.org/I4210153527"]}]},{"author_position":"middle","author":{"id":"https://openalex.org/A5082946682","display_name":"Mohamed Dahchour","orcid":null},"institutions":[{"id":"https://openalex.org/I4210153527","display_name":"Institut National des Postes et T\u00e9l\u00e9communications","ror":"https://ror.org/052bnvt46","country_code":"MA","type":"education","lineage":["https://openalex.org/I4210153527","https://openalex.org/I4210167103"]}],"countries":["MA"],"is_corresponding":false,"raw_author_name":"Mohamed Dahchour","raw_affiliation_strings":["National Institute of Posts and Telecommunications, Rabat, Morocco"],"affiliations":[{"raw_affiliation_string":"National Institute of Posts and Telecommunications, Rabat, Morocco","institution_ids":["https://openalex.org/I4210153527"]}]},{"author_position":"last","author":{"id":"https://openalex.org/A5050355536","display_name":"Abdeslam En\u2010Nouaary","orcid":null},"institutions":[{"id":"https://openalex.org/I4210153527","display_name":"Institut National des Postes et T\u00e9l\u00e9communications","ror":"https://ror.org/052bnvt46","country_code":"MA","type":"education","lineage":["https://openalex.org/I4210153527","https://openalex.org/I4210167103"]}],"countries":["MA"],"is_corresponding":false,"raw_author_name":"Abdeslam En-nouaary","raw_affiliation_strings":["National Institute of Posts and Telecommunications, Rabat, Morocco"],"affiliations":[{"raw_affiliation_string":"National Institute of Posts and Telecommunications, Rabat, Morocco","institution_ids":["https://openalex.org/I4210153527"]}]}],"institutions":[],"countries_distinct_count":1,"institutions_distinct_count":3,"corresponding_author_ids":["https://openalex.org/A5011181608"],"corresponding_institution_ids":["https://openalex.org/I4210153527"],"apc_list":null,"apc_paid":null,"fwci":0.9673,"has_fulltext":true,"cited_by_count":4,"citation_normalized_percentile":{"value":0.81959074,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":{"min":90,"max":96},"biblio":{"volume":"12","issue":"6","first_page":"454","last_page":"471"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":0.9994999766349792,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":0.9994999766349792,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T12127","display_name":"Software System Performance and Reliability","score":0.9987000226974487,"subfield":{"id":"https://openalex.org/subfields/1705","display_name":"Computer Networks and Communications"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T11450","display_name":"Model-Driven Software Engineering Techniques","score":0.9979000091552734,"subfield":{"id":"https://openalex.org/subfields/1712","display_name":"Software"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.8862468004226685},{"id":"https://openalex.org/keywords/unified-modeling-language","display_name":"Unified Modeling Language","score":0.7354243993759155},{"id":"https://openalex.org/keywords/software-engineering","display_name":"Software engineering","score":0.5578038692474365},{"id":"https://openalex.org/keywords/applications-of-uml","display_name":"Applications of UML","score":0.5128224492073059},{"id":"https://openalex.org/keywords/process","display_name":"Process (computing)","score":0.5064109563827515},{"id":"https://openalex.org/keywords/set","display_name":"Set (abstract data type)","score":0.4798659682273865},{"id":"https://openalex.org/keywords/iterative-and-incremental-development","display_name":"Iterative and incremental development","score":0.44216153025627136},{"id":"https://openalex.org/keywords/software","display_name":"Software","score":0.4108654856681824},{"id":"https://openalex.org/keywords/programming-language","display_name":"Programming language","score":0.2671889066696167}],"concepts":[{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.8862468004226685},{"id":"https://openalex.org/C145644426","wikidata":"https://www.wikidata.org/wiki/Q169411","display_name":"Unified Modeling Language","level":3,"score":0.7354243993759155},{"id":"https://openalex.org/C115903868","wikidata":"https://www.wikidata.org/wiki/Q80993","display_name":"Software engineering","level":1,"score":0.5578038692474365},{"id":"https://openalex.org/C41298492","wikidata":"https://www.wikidata.org/wiki/Q4781506","display_name":"Applications of UML","level":4,"score":0.5128224492073059},{"id":"https://openalex.org/C98045186","wikidata":"https://www.wikidata.org/wiki/Q205663","display_name":"Process (computing)","level":2,"score":0.5064109563827515},{"id":"https://openalex.org/C177264268","wikidata":"https://www.wikidata.org/wiki/Q1514741","display_name":"Set (abstract data type)","level":2,"score":0.4798659682273865},{"id":"https://openalex.org/C143587482","wikidata":"https://www.wikidata.org/wiki/Q1543216","display_name":"Iterative and incremental development","level":2,"score":0.44216153025627136},{"id":"https://openalex.org/C2777904410","wikidata":"https://www.wikidata.org/wiki/Q7397","display_name":"Software","level":2,"score":0.4108654856681824},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.2671889066696167}],"mesh":[],"locations_count":1,"locations":[{"id":"doi:10.17706/jsw.12.6.454-471","is_oa":true,"landing_page_url":"https://doi.org/10.17706/jsw.12.6.454-471","pdf_url":"http://www.jsoftware.us/vol12/263-JSW15240.pdf","source":{"id":"https://openalex.org/S114141714","display_name":"Journal of Software","issn_l":"1796-217X","issn":["1796-217X"],"is_oa":true,"is_in_doaj":false,"is_core":true,"host_organization":"https://openalex.org/P4310318660","host_organization_name":"Academy Publisher","host_organization_lineage":["https://openalex.org/P4310318660"],"host_organization_lineage_names":["Academy Publisher"],"type":"journal"},"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Journal of Software","raw_type":"journal-article"}],"best_oa_location":{"id":"doi:10.17706/jsw.12.6.454-471","is_oa":true,"landing_page_url":"https://doi.org/10.17706/jsw.12.6.454-471","pdf_url":"http://www.jsoftware.us/vol12/263-JSW15240.pdf","source":{"id":"https://openalex.org/S114141714","display_name":"Journal of Software","issn_l":"1796-217X","issn":["1796-217X"],"is_oa":true,"is_in_doaj":false,"is_core":true,"host_organization":"https://openalex.org/P4310318660","host_organization_name":"Academy Publisher","host_organization_lineage":["https://openalex.org/P4310318660"],"host_organization_lineage_names":["Academy Publisher"],"type":"journal"},"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Journal of Software","raw_type":"journal-article"},"sustainable_development_goals":[],"awards":[],"funders":[],"has_content":{"pdf":true,"grobid_xml":true},"content_urls":{"pdf":"https://content.openalex.org/works/W2627018814.pdf","grobid_xml":"https://content.openalex.org/works/W2627018814.grobid-xml"},"referenced_works_count":49,"referenced_works":["https://openalex.org/W8913454","https://openalex.org/W1489225646","https://openalex.org/W1533622576","https://openalex.org/W1567164553","https://openalex.org/W1568810014","https://openalex.org/W1576124861","https://openalex.org/W1701653567","https://openalex.org/W1750846455","https://openalex.org/W1861788721","https://openalex.org/W1921371332","https://openalex.org/W1976025929","https://openalex.org/W2004901564","https://openalex.org/W2009842179","https://openalex.org/W2027346590","https://openalex.org/W2047193350","https://openalex.org/W2062588192","https://openalex.org/W2075390294","https://openalex.org/W2103291080","https://openalex.org/W2111445678","https://openalex.org/W2112775311","https://openalex.org/W2113361184","https://openalex.org/W2113748085","https://openalex.org/W2131552632","https://openalex.org/W2145498882","https://openalex.org/W2153304141","https://openalex.org/W2162686404","https://openalex.org/W2183128812","https://openalex.org/W2261074833","https://openalex.org/W2291955792","https://openalex.org/W2366452072","https://openalex.org/W2414382416","https://openalex.org/W2538679163","https://openalex.org/W2569854715","https://openalex.org/W2587975526","https://openalex.org/W2593645664","https://openalex.org/W2613005695","https://openalex.org/W2919406383","https://openalex.org/W4237764470","https://openalex.org/W4240886822","https://openalex.org/W4242926184","https://openalex.org/W4298186903","https://openalex.org/W4301492281","https://openalex.org/W6629280562","https://openalex.org/W6637650074","https://openalex.org/W6637821255","https://openalex.org/W6683880777","https://openalex.org/W6728308297","https://openalex.org/W6966965615","https://openalex.org/W7015268156"],"related_works":["https://openalex.org/W2083641877","https://openalex.org/W2387087283","https://openalex.org/W2368891820","https://openalex.org/W207211690","https://openalex.org/W4256577339","https://openalex.org/W3119629122","https://openalex.org/W1971046215","https://openalex.org/W2162768729","https://openalex.org/W2360255973","https://openalex.org/W9184641"],"abstract_inverted_index":{"Software":[0],"systems":[1],"are":[2],"often":[3],"modeled":[4],"as":[5],"a":[6,61,73,111],"set":[7],"of":[8,18,28,42,64,93],"related":[9],"UML":[10,19],"diagrams.":[11],"Due":[12],"to":[13,22,45,97],"the":[14,23,29,54,65,80],"overlapping":[15],"multi-view":[16],"nature":[17,27],"and":[20,25,48],"due":[21],"incremental":[24],"iterative":[26],"used":[30],"software":[31],"development":[32],"process,":[33],"these":[34,50],"diagrams":[35],"might":[36],"contain":[37],"inconsistencies.":[38,116],"Thus,":[39],"it":[40],"is":[41,96],"utmost":[43],"importance":[44],"detect,":[46],"analyze":[47],"fix":[49],"inconsistencies":[51,85],"before":[52],"implementing":[53],"system.":[55],"In":[56],"this":[57,70,94],"paper,":[58],"we":[59],"elaborate":[60],"transverse":[62],"view":[63],"aforementioned":[66],"activities.":[67],"More":[68],"explicitly,":[69],"work":[71],"proposes":[72],"Systematic":[74],"Literature":[75],"Review":[76],"(SLR)":[77],"that":[78,103],"evaluates":[79],"existing":[81],"techniques":[82],"for":[83,114],"managing":[84],"using":[86],"different":[87],"research":[88],"questions.":[89],"The":[90],"ultimate":[91],"objective":[92],"review":[95],"come":[98],"up":[99],"with":[100],"new":[101,112],"recommendations":[102],"should":[104],"be":[105],"taken":[106],"into":[107],"consideration":[108],"when":[109],"conceiving":[110],"proposal":[113],"checking":[115]},"counts_by_year":[{"year":2022,"cited_by_count":2},{"year":2019,"cited_by_count":1},{"year":2018,"cited_by_count":1}],"updated_date":"2026-01-13T01:12:25.745995","created_date":"2017-06-23T00:00:00"}
